This print showcases the stunning Church of S. Marta and Agli in the province of Turin, Italy. With its intricate architecture and rich history, this church is a true testament to late Baroque, Baroque, and Renaissance-Baroque styles. Dating back to 1760, this magnificent structure stands tall as a symbol of European artistry from the first and second millenniums A. D. The photograph itself was taken in 1956 by Alinari, Fratelli - a renowned name in capturing timeless beauty. The image captures various elements that make this church truly remarkable. From the balustrade made of exquisite marble to the meticulously crafted portal showcasing applied arts and crafts, every detail speaks volumes about the dedication put into its construction. As you gaze at this photo print, your eyes are drawn to the grand arches and columns that adorn the facade. The pilasters on either side add an extra touch of elegance while leading your vision towards the lantern-topped bell tower.
